The History of Freemasonry And Its Origins
Freemasonry has a rich and mysterious history that extends back centuries. Its origins can be traced to the middle ages stonemasons guilds that ran in Europe during the building of cathedrals. These guilds, referred to as operative lodges, had stringent regulations and practices to make sure the high quality of their craftsmanship.
As societal modifications happened, these guilds started accepting non-masons as members, giving rise to speculative lodges, such as New Mills Masonic Lodge.
The values of Freemasonry, such as brotherly love, truth and charity, were embedded into its foundation and have remained true throughout its history. In time, Freemasonry spread worldwide and developed into a vast network of Masonic Lodges, such as New Mills Masonic Lodge, that continue to support these principles while adjusting to contemporary times.

Functions and hierarchy within a New Mills Masonic Lodge,
Within a New Mills Masonic Lodge, there is a clear hierarchy and numerous roles that members satisfy. At the top of the hierarchy is the Worshipful Master, who is responsible for leading the lodge and commanding meetings. The Senior Warden and Junior Warden assist the Worshipful Master and may presume leadership in their possible absence.
Other important officer positions consist of the Treasurer, who handles the finances of New Mills lodge, and the Secretary, who manages administrative jobs and keeps records. Additionally, there are officers such as the Chaplain, who supplies spiritual guidance, and the Tyler, who secures the entrance to guarantee only qualified people go into.
Each officer has specific duties and responsibilities, laid out in the lodge’s bylaws and customs. Their roles may consist of carrying out rituals, managing committees, arranging occasions, and keeping order throughout New Mills Masonic Lodge conferences.

Explanation of Masonic Degrees And Their Significance At New Mills
In New Mills Masonic Lodge, degrees play a crucial function in the progression of Freemasons. Each degree represents a phase of initiation and imparts valuable teachings and lessons.
The Gone into Apprentice degree focuses on the importance of self-improvement and discovering basic ethical principles. It symbolizes the beginning of the Masonic journey and highlights the duty to conduct oneself with stability.
The Fellow Craft degree delves deeper into the research study of understanding, particularly concentrating on the sciences and arts. It motivates members to pursue intellectual growth and understanding, fostering personal development.
The Master Mason degree is the highest and crucial degree within New Mills Masonic Lodge It signifies wisdom, completion, and mastery over oneself. This degree communicates essential styles of death, resurrection, and immortality.
Through these degrees, Freemasons find out important values such as brotherhood, moral conduct, self-control, and individual development. Indicating behind typical symbols utilized at New Mills Masonic Lodge. The symbols used at New Mills Masonic Lodge hold deep meaning and convey important concepts to their members. One such symbol is the square and compasses, representing morality and virtue. The square symbolizes honesty and fairness in all transactions, while the compasses advise Masons at New Mills to keep their desires and enthusiasms within due bounds. Together, they work as a constant reminder for members to lead upright lives.
Another common symbol in New Mills Masonic Lodge is the pillars, normally depicted as two columns, representing wisdom, strength, and charm. These pillars are tips for Masons to look for understanding, empower themselves with self-control, and value the charm that exists in the world.
The apron used by Masons at New Mills are also a substantial sign. It represents the pureness of heart and devotion to the craft. It serves as a visual suggestion of the Masonic worths of humbleness, stability, and dedication to self-improvement.

Symbolism of New Mills Masonic Lodge architecture and layout
The architecture and layout of New Mills Masonic Lodge are abundant with meaning, reflecting the principles and worths of Freemasonry. One crucial aspect is the orientation of the lodge, typically dealing with east. This instructions represents the dawn of enlightenment and clean slates, representing the constant pursuit of knowledge and spiritual development.
The lodge space itself is decorated with various signs, such as the altar, which serves as the center of focus throughout ceremonies and represents a commitment to moral and spiritual teachings. The pillars at the entrance, frequently modeled after those in King Solomon’s Temple, represent strength and knowledge.
The arrangement of seating within the lodge space likewise brings significance. The Junior Warden’s chair is placed in the south to signify the heat of passion and youthful energy, while the Senior Warden’s chair remains in the west to represent maturity and reflection. The Master’s chair, located in the east, signifies leadership and enlightenment.
